I purchased an Onkyo 606 receiver about 6 months ago and have not any problems until recently.....
In case it makes any difference here's my setup Onkyo 606 Receiver Toshiba 40" LCD TV (HDMI via receiver output) KEF 2001.2 Speakers (6.1) PS3 (HDMI for Audio and Video) SKY HD (HDMI for Audio and Video) About a week ago I was burgled and the intruder had disconnected my television and ripped it from it's stand before being disturbed by my wife. He fled and left with nothing (apart from a PS3 controller). After re-connecting the TV all seemed well.... However, the next day the ONKYO went into protection mode(PM) after some use. The only way I could exit PM was to power off the onkyo for a short period of time. It was then after many hours of use when the Onkyo repeated the PM error and then I had to power off again. The next time in entered PM, removing the power did not clear the error. I therefore decided to troubleshoot the problem but since the issue is so intermittent, I'm not sure what testing I have done proved anything. I disconnected all HDMI connections and used the inbuilt radio as input, PM problem still exists. disconnected all speakers and tested each speaker to be working on the centre channel. All speakers were fully functional. I then connected speakers to each channel individually. Funny thing was that when I connected speakers to the Front Left channel, the Onkyo went into PM. This was repeated several times with many different cables and speakers. It became impossible to recover from this situation all other channels worked fine. I then decided to factory reset the Onkyo. All speaker channels worked fine and slowly reuild the connectivity and configuration with no issues. All seemed when and then after 15 mins of running (at very low volume) the Onkyo returned to PM. It was possible to recover from this by turning the Onkyo back on. Then PM returned an hour later...switch on again and now running OK. It's been running for about 3 hours now with no problem however, I'm waiting for the PM problem to return. Any pointers please...... |
